Warning Signs You Need High-Velocity Air Mover Drying
Don’t ignore these warning signs, they can show a more serious problem that needs High-Velocity Air Mover Drying: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, lingering odors can show the presence of mold or mildew. If you notice a musty smell that persists despite your best efforts to remove it, it may be time to call in the professionals.
Water Stains on Your Ceiling
Water stains on your ceiling can be a sign of a leak or water damage. If you notice a stain that’s getting larger or spreading, it’s time to act fast to prevent further damage.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ring can show that the subfloor is damaged or compromised. If you notice your flooring is warping or buckling, it may be time to call in the professionals to assess the damage.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Peeling paint or wallpaper can show that the underlying surface is damaged or compromised. If you notice your paint or wallpaper is peeling, it may be a sign of a more serious problem.
Visible Water Damage

Common Questions About High-Velocity Air Mover Drying
What is High-Velocity Air Mover Drying?
High-Velocity Air Mover Drying is a specialized service that uses powerful fans to speed up the drying process, reducing damage and reducing the risk of mold growth.
How Long Does High-Velocity Air Mover Drying Take?
The length of time it takes to complete High-Velocity Air Mover Drying can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Typically, it takes 3-5 days to complete the process.
